Decorative gravel delivery services involve the transportation and placement of various types of gravel and stone materials to enhance outdoor spaces. These services typically include the delivery of bulk quantities of gravel, ensuring it arrives clean and ready for use. Once delivered, contractors can assist with spreading, leveling, and shaping the gravel to create a smooth and attractive surface. This process helps homeowners achieve a polished look for pathways, garden beds, patios, or decorative features without the hassle of sourcing and transporting heavy materials themselves.
Many property owners turn to decorative gravel delivery services to solve common landscaping challenges. Gravel can serve as an affordable and low-maintenance alternative to paved surfaces, reducing the need for regular upkeep and weed control. It also provides effective drainage, preventing water pooling and erosion around walkways or garden areas. Additionally, gravel can act as a visual focal point, adding texture and color contrast to outdoor designs. These services are often sought after when replacing old, worn-out surfaces or when creating new landscape features that require a stable and attractive foundation.

The overview below groups typical Decorative Gravel Delivery proj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or decorative gravel projects, such as patching or small areas, us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on material and site conditions.
Standard Installations - For standard driveway or pathway installations,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$4,000 or more, but most jobs tend to stay within the mid-tier range.
Full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of existing gravel surfaces generally costs between $3,500 and $7,000. These larger projects are less common and tend to push into higher cost brackets depending on scope and site size.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ive decorative gravel landscaping or commercial installations can exceed $10,000, with costs depending heavily on size and design complexity. Many local service providers can accommodate a variety of project sizes within this range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of decorative gravel are available for delivery? Local contractors often offer a variety of decorative gravel options, including pea gravel, river rock, crushed granite, and marble chips, allowing for customization based on aesthetic preferences.
How can I ensure the decorative gravel I choose is suitable for my project? Service providers can help assess your needs and recommend the best type of gravel for your specific application, whether for pathways, garden beds, or landscaping features.
Do local contractors provide installation services for decorative gravel? Many service providers offer installation as part of their offerings, ensuring proper placement and compaction for a durable and attractive finish.
What factors should I consider when selecting decorative gravel for my property? Consider the color, size, and texture of the gravel, as well as its suitability for your climate and landscape design, with guidance from local pros.
Can I get decorative gravel delivered in specific quantities for my project? Yes, local service providers typically supply gravel in various quantities to match the scope of your project, from small garden beds to large landscaping areas.
